Inter Milan open to new Lukaku deal with Chelsea
Inter Milan GM Beppe Marotta has revealed they’re ready to open talks with Chelsea about a new Romelu Lukaku deal.
Lukaku has spent this season on-loan at Inter from Chelsea.
Ahead of the Champions League final against Manchester City, Marotta commented on strike-duo Lukaku and Edin Dzeko.

Marotta said: “Dzeko’s contract is running down and Lukaku is only on loan, he is not our player.
“We are happy to begin new negotiations with Chelsea, but that is a difficult thing to predict right now, as we will sit down with the club hierarchy and plan next season. They are both great professionals and excellent players.”
